| Re: Guess where I got these
Rear upper and lowers should have 66mm links with 12mm spacers. I see you have spacers - what about the frame length? Should be at WB2 I believe? Ascender Wheel Base & Link Reference Guide *EDIT* It looks like you flipped battery tray mounts around? With the links mounted up there it might be what is pulling your axle out of alignment, though I see you do not have the spacers in there.. Hmm. I had a similar problem when I flipped the tray mounts to relocate the rear links, so I flipped it back and put everything back to what the manual says and everything lined up properly.
